Maybe you already have a solid email list that continues to engage with your content. But did

you know that the average email list decay is over 22% per year? This means 22% of your

contacts will unsubscribe, change companies (and email addresses), or get a new email

address. This is why it’s super important to continuously work on building your list.

WHY BUILD AN EMAIL LIST? It’s yours.

What would happen to your business if Instagram

and Facebook decided to shut their doors tomorrow

(taking your followers with them!)? Chances are,

you’d feel lost without an audience. Your email list,

on the other hand, is yours to keep. You can contact

your subscribers anytime.

It’s personal.

Customizing your emails based on the information

you know about your subscribers is an awesome

feature. Most email software tools will allow you to

personalize based on the recipient’s name, company,

and other data you’re actively collecting through

forms.

It’s affordable

On average, businesses in the US earn $44 for every

$1 spent on email marketing. When compared to

the huge costs associated with outbound marketing,

email is extremely affordable. All you need is a tool

to send emails and some time each week to craft

your message.

It’s everywhere

Not everyone will have an Instagram account or a LinkedIn profile, but it’s safe to say

that your persona or target audience has an email address. Further, thanks to tech

advancements, people can check their email on their smartphone, activity tracker,

tablet, and even their smart TV!

1. GIVE IT A COOL NAME Naming your email list an “email list” or “newsletter list” likely won’t convince your audience to join it. On average, people receive 121 emails per day. Signing up for another newsletter might overwhelm your visitors. Instead, give it a cool name like a: •  Insider’s club •  Tribe •  Exclusive member’s group

2. HOST A GIVEAWAY People love free stuff. Host a contest on your website where you’ll giveaway a free product or service in exchange for an email address. Try tools like Wishpond or Gleam to take care of the sign up and logistics.

3. EXIT INTENT POP-UP Whether you love them or hate them, pop-ups work. Entrepreneur.com increased email sign ups by 86% and sales by 162% by implementing a pop-up. Depending on the plugin or tool you use, you can select whether the pop-up appears upon rapid mouse movements, after a specific amount of time, or after your user scrolls to a certain part of your page.

4. ADD ADDITIONAL SIGN UP OPPORTUNITIES Make it easy for visitors to join your email list, especially if they exit your pop-up but later decide they’re interested in your content. Add a static banner on your website or button in your navigation.

5. USE CALLS-TO-ACTION (CTAs) AT THE END OF BLOGS Including an image-based CTA at the end of every blog post is an excellent opportunity to convince your readers that they need to join your email list. You’ve just shared a valuable and interesting blog post and if they want to continue reading your content, signing up for your newsletter will allow them to do so. Ensure your CTA stands out and describes the value in signing up.

Page 7: 15 SIMPLE HACKS TO BUILD YOUR EMAIL LIST...10. PROMOTE THE OPT IN PAGE ON SOCIAL MEDIA Once you’ve got a dedicated landing page on your website to collect email subscribers, share

6. EMBED YOUR FORM IN THE SIDEBAR Adding a sign up form to your blog sidebar ensures that it will be seen by your readers, if they don’t happen to get to the end of the blog.

7. LEVERAGE YOUR FACEBOOK COVER IMAGE Use your Facebook cover image as a CTA! Create a custom graphic that entices your audience to sign up for your newsletter. Ensure that your CTA link directs users to a page on your website that’s easy to sign up.

9. RUN ADS ON SOCIAL MEDIA Thanks to recent algorithm updates, reaching your audience on social media may be harder than ever. Putting some spend behind an advertising campaign can help you increase brand awareness and drive more sign ups. You can choose whether you want to target brand new individuals who aren’t aware of your business (based on demographic and behavioural criteria) or target individuals already familiar with your business, but didn’t join your email list.

9. CREATE A CONTENT OFFER OR FREEBIE. As email marketing becomes more and more popular, people can tend to get protective over giving out their address. They need to see the value in your content. Create a freebie to giveaway in exchange for your audience’s email address to help build up your list. Here are some freebie ideas that might make sense for your business: •  Checklist •  Template •  Worksheet •  How-to guide •  Comparison guide •  Report •  Images/graphics •  eBook •  Preview of your book/eBook •  Webinar recording •  Email series •  Online course •  Desktop wallpaper

10. PROMOTE THE OPT IN PAGE ON SOCIAL MEDIA Once you’ve got a dedicated landing page on your website to collect email subscribers, share it! Add this link in your Instagram profile, pin it to the top of your Facebook page, and the other social media accounts you’re using.

11. FORWARD TO A FRIEND You’re likely not starting from scratch and currently engaging your list with emails from time to time. If they see value in your emails and content, they’ll be much more likely to share it with a friend, family member, or colleague so make it easy to do so! Add buttons or a call-to-action in your emails encouraging people to share your email. Make it really simple!

12. OFFER DIFFERENT SUBSCRIPTION OPTIONS Sometimes if visitors can see how often they will receive emails, they’re more likely to opt-in. Try offering 3 different subscription options: •  As soon as you publish insightful tips •  Weekly •  Monthly

13. HOST A WEBINAR Is there a certain topic that you get asked about often? Host a free webinar and use a landing page to collect sign ups.

14. ADD A LINK IN YOUR OWN EMAIL SIGNATURE Link to the opt in landing page in your own (and employees) email signatures. You never know who is forwarding and seeing your emails!

15. OFFER AN INCENTIVE This is an excellent option for online stores/eCommerce businesses. Offering 10% off their first order is a sure-fire way to build your email list. This approach can also work for service-based businesses, too. However, be sure that you’re giving your visitors enough time to learn about your product/services before offering a discount.
